About Josip Sliško
Josip Sliško is a scholar working on Education, Statistical and Nonlinear Physics, Developmental and Educational Psychology, Astronomy and Astrophysics and Media Technology, having authored 80 papers that have together received 372 indexed citations. Recurring topics across this work include Science Education and Pedagogy (24 papers), Experimental and Theoretical Physics Studies (18 papers), Innovative Teaching Methods (14 papers), Education and Critical Thinking Development (13 papers), Educational methodologies and cognitive development (7 papers), Experimental Learning in Engineering (5 papers), Knowledge Societies in the 21st Century (5 papers) and Educational Strategies and Epistemologies (5 papers). The work is most often cited by research in Education (234 citations), Developmental and Educational Psychology (64 citations), Statistical and Nonlinear Physics (64 citations), Computer Science Applications (20 citations) and Media Technology (27 citations). Josip Sliško has collaborated with scholars based in Mexico, Croatia and Slovenia. Frequent co-authors include Gorazd Planinšič, Dewey I. Dykstra, Adrián Estrada Corona, J. Radovanović, Ivana Stepanović, Rafael Garcia‐Molina, Mirjana Božić, Radoš Gajić, Isabel Abril and Lucía Romero. Their work appears in journals such as The Physics Teacher, Physics Education, Research in Science & Technological Education, International Journal of Science Education and Physical Review Special Topics - Physics Education Research.
